|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
|
Опции темы | Поиск в этой теме |
24.05.2017, 14:20 | #1 |
Новичок
Джуниор
Регистрация: 24.05.2017
Сообщений: 1
|
[PascalABC] Что то не догоняю.Array Massive
Код:
Где 2? Помогите ребят ______________________ Используйте тег [CODE] (кнопка с решеткой # в форме сообщения) при вставке кода на форум. Последний раз редактировалось Alex11223; 24.05.2017 в 14:47. |
24.05.2017, 14:46 | #2 |
Старожил
Регистрация: 17.11.2010
Сообщений: 18,922
|
А чего ты насчитал? Оно и выдаст 7 - индекс первого максимального элемента. Если считал присвоения в цикле, то 3 раза
Если бы архитекторы строили здания так, как программисты пишут программы, то первый залетевший дятел разрушил бы цивилизацию
|
24.05.2017, 14:58 | #3 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
|
26.05.2017, 11:32 | #4 |
Старожил
Регистрация: 04.02.2011
Сообщений: 4,619
|
У меня прорезалась телепатия: у человека в A[k] > A[m] знак > не тем концом повернут или индексы местами поменены, во он и нашел минимальный элемент 14. Видно текст для форума и тот, что в компе - не совпадает, не скопи-пастен, а руками набирался.
Ой нет, пардон - тогда было бы 12. Значит, вмешательство внешних сил. Или парниковый эффект Последний раз редактировалось digitalis; 26.05.2017 в 11:36. |
26.05.2017, 11:41 | #5 |
Форумчанин
Регистрация: 09.05.2017
Сообщений: 751
|
- по каким признакам это видно?
Напишу программу на C++ и Asm для AVR. Черчение: sergeisky@yahoo.com.
|
26.05.2017, 11:47 | #6 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
ничего у Вас не прорезалось, можете не переживать.
в массиве из 10 элементов не может быть индекса 12. тогда выдалось бы 8 (индекс/номер минимального элемента) Но это всё неважно. потому как: 1) автор темы пропал 2) абсолютно непонятно, почему у него +1 и что он, собственно, подсчитывал. (обратите внимание - именно - подсчитывал, а не искал! что означают его +1..) |
26.05.2017, 12:25 | #7 |
Старожил
Регистрация: 16.05.2012
Сообщений: 3,211
|
Довольно странно считать, что написанная Вами по известному только Вам алгоритму программа даёт правильный ответ, когда у Вас получается совершенно другой (субъективно тоже правильный) ответ.
Но самое смешное, что объективно ни Вы, ни программа насчитали неправильно - правильный ответ 4 Хотя если считается количество уникальных значений, больших пятнадцати - то да, их действительно 5.
Начал решать проблему с помощью регулярных выражений. Теперь решаю две проблемы...
Последний раз редактировалось Sciv; 26.05.2017 в 12:29. |
26.05.2017, 12:47 | #8 |
Старожил
Регистрация: 04.02.2011
Сообщений: 4,619
|
Да очень просто - если скопипастить этот текст из форума в паскалевский файл и запустить его, то получится правильный ответ: 7. Ошибку можно допустить только при переносе. Вариант: неисправен комп; считает, но неправильно - даже не рассматриваем.
Я имел в виду не индекс, а значение 12 - мин. элемент при перевернутом ' < ' LinuXxXовод молодец - классный тролль-топик вбросил. Вспоинаю у В.Конецкого : "Почему у всех животных есть селезенка, а у лошадей - нет?" Последний раз редактировалось digitalis; 26.05.2017 в 16:46. |
26.05.2017, 22:09 | #9 |
Цифровой кот
Старожил
Регистрация: 29.08.2014
Сообщений: 7,629
|
:\
Расскажу я вам, дружочки, как выращивать грибочки: нужно в поле утром рано сдвинуть два куска урана...
|
26.05.2017, 22:29 | #10 |
Старожил
Регистрация: 04.02.2011
Сообщений: 4,619
|
min@y™ классная видяха. но для такой простой задачи - это из пушки не по воробьям даже, а по блохам. А в какой среде все это делалось ? QIP Shot ?
Последний раз редактировалось digitalis; 26.05.2017 в 22:38. |
|
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Для чего существует коммутативность array[2] == 2[array] | _PROGRAMM_ | Помощь студентам | 10 | 02.11.2014 13:33 |
не догоняю | trebor | Свободное общение | 2 | 08.08.2010 19:34 |
Massive. | Paul Oakenfold | Паскаль, Turbo Pascal, PascalABC.NET | 19 | 23.04.2009 19:01 |
Massive | Paul Oakenfold | Паскаль, Turbo Pascal, PascalABC.NET | 0 | 11.04.2009 20:32 |